Why Locs Are a Beautiful Choice for Little Girls
Locs give little girls a protective style that grows with them and requires less daily manipulation than loose natural hair.
Many parents choose locs for their daughters because the style is durable, manageable, and deeply connected to Black cultural heritage and identity. Styled with beads, barrettes, bows, or left beautifully simple, locs give children a hairstyle they can truly own.
